Startup Lending and Alternative Financing

Traditional bank loans can be difficult for new startups to secure, especially during the early stages of business development. As a result, many entrepreneurs rely on alternative funding providers and startup-focused financing organizations.

One example is StartCap, which offers startup loans, equipment financing, lines of credit, and SBA funding options for entrepreneurs in Lake Worth. Their programs are designed specifically for early-stage businesses that may not qualify for traditional lending.

Alternative lenders in the Lake Worth area often provide:

  • Startup business loans
  • Equipment financing
  • Working capital
  • SBA-backed loans
  • Commercial real estate funding
  • Flexible repayment options

These financing programs allow startups to invest in operations, inventory, marketing, staffing, and technology development.

Community Development and Local Financing Programs

Lake Worth also benefits from community-focused funding initiatives aimed at encouraging local business growth and economic revitalization.

The Lake Worth CRA Small Business Loan Program helps support entrepreneurs through targeted financing programs designed for local businesses and redevelopment projects. The program focuses on improving commercial districts, creating jobs, and encouraging business expansion within the community.

Funding eligibility may include:

  • Permanent working capital
  • Business expansion
  • Equipment purchases
  • Bridge financing
  • Property improvements

Programs like these are particularly valuable for entrepreneurs who want to build locally focused businesses while contributing to economic development in Lake Worth.

Challenges Facing Startup Financing in Lake Worth

Despite growing opportunities, startups in Lake Worth still face several challenges.

Limited Venture Capital Availability

Compared to Silicon Valley, New York, or Austin, South Florida still has fewer large venture capital firms. Some entrepreneurs in online startup communities mention that Miami currently offers stronger access to venture capital than Palm Beach County.

Competitive Funding Environment

Investors increasingly expect startups to demonstrate:

  • Strong leadership
  • Scalable business models
  • Revenue potential
  • Market differentiation
  • Financial discipline

Businesses without clear growth strategies may struggle to secure investment.

Economic Uncertainty

Interest rate changes, inflation, and shifting economic conditions can affect startup fundraising activity. Entrepreneurs must often adapt quickly to changing investor expectations.
